1、SDN开发环境的搭建(win7环境) 2、SDN控制器的使用(ubuntu环境搭建、controller使用、mininet的使用) 3、ODL源码编译生成发行版控制器 4、md-sal应用程序开发指南 5、应用程序集成到ODL控制器 6、yang模型详解 7、md-sal的l2switch源码分析 正文 在开发SDN应用程序之前,需要先搭建好开发环境,鉴于开发java代码大家...
Ubuntu环境下的SDN开发环境搭建以及Mininet编程,主要包括SDN网络基本知识以及实验环境搭建,流表项安装以及网络连通性测试。
SDN环境搭建(mininet,OVS,ryu安装及命令) 1、mininet安装与使用 1.1mininet安装 ubuntu 12.04/14.04/14.10 命令行 sudo apt-get install mininet 1.2 mininet基本命令 nodes:查看全部节点 net:查看链路信息 dump:查看各节点详细信息 mn –c:mininet退出后,清理 pingall:测试所有结点是否连通 网络调试命令: 格式:node ...
mininet+floodlight搭建sdn环境并创建简答topo 第一步:安装git sudo apt-get update sudo apt-get install git 测试git是否安装成功: git 第二步:安装mininet 1.获取mininet最新源码树 git clone git://github.com/mininet/mininet 会在当前目录下创建mininet文件夹 2.安装mininet cd mininet/util 进入mininet目录 ...
一种基于SDN的云计算安全保护系统及方法具体上总控制平台通过支持SDN的虚拟交换机和虚拟化平台的接口,在不影响正常业务工作的情况下自动识别安全需求的变化,在云计算中心的各地、各主机上快速地部署或关闭虚拟器件,能有效地保护云计算中心网络环境和其中虚拟机的安全,其功能模块图如图1-9所示。
SDN集成开发环境——NetIDE 一、NetIDE综述 这部分内容方便大家对于这款NetIDE工具有一个直观的印象。 NetIDE是一款面向SDN网络应用程序开发的集成环境。它的基本框架是基于eclipse,但是在eclipse基础之上增加了很多插件。其可视化的界面大概是下面这个样子: 与传统的网络可视化编辑工具类似,用户可以通过简单的拖拽就能配置...
SDN入门——环境配置 咨诹 互联网行业底层牛马 目录 收起 一、介绍 1、p4c 2、Mininet 二、p4c安装 三、Mininet安装 关于SDN环境配置,可以选择偷懒,使用他人配置好的虚拟环境,但我觉得这容易出现环境版本过低等各种问题。所以我更推荐在自己的虚拟机(或linux系统),搭建自己的环境。 本文粗略的讲解一下如何安...
Mininet是一个网络模拟器,允许你创建一个虚拟网络环境来测试SDN控制器和其他网络组件。Opendaylight是一个开源的SDN控制器,它实现了OpenFlow协议,用于控制网络流量。而Wireshark则是一个网络协议分析器,它可以让你查看网络中的数据包并理解它们是如何在SDN环境中流动的。 本文将带你一步步搭建这样一个环境,并提供清晰...
说明:由于对于SDN架构的理解在学界和业界并没有统一,对于初学者,推荐OpenFlow作为南向接口来实现SDN环境,以下给出分别针对采用OpenFlow和采用其他接口的具体要求。 针对采用OpenFlow作为南向接口的要求:首先需要搭建一个SDN架构的网络环境,初学者可以采用一个最简单的拓扑结构,熟练的人可以自定义复杂一点的拓扑结构,两者...
SDN作为一种新型的网络技术,也可以为国际环境保护合作提供新的思路和方法。 1. 节能减排 SDN可以通过对网络资源的智能管理,实现网络的节能和减排。传统网络由于架构的局限性,往往存在能耗高、资源利用率低的问题。而SDN可以根据实际的网络流量和需求,动态调整网络设备的工作状态,以达到节能减排的目的。在国际环境保护...